In 2020, the Osservatorio regionale del paesaggio of the Regione del Veneto (Landscape Observatory of the Veneto Region) promoted an international conference to commemorate the 20th anniversary of the European Landscape Convention adopted by the Committee of Ministers of Culture and Environment of the Council of Europe. Adopting an interdisciplinary and comparative approach, this volume collects the outputs of critical thinking about the impact and effects of the European Landscape Convention on the social, environmental, juridical, architectural, archaeological and managerial spheres, and presents a wide selection of theoretical and research essays, critical remarks and case studies.
